Sony DSC-G1 Wireless Digital Camera

1173380263_DSC-G1_CCW_med.jpgThought we will give you a break from all the GE cameras and talk about good old Sony. The folks at Sony just unveiled its first wireless digital camera, the Sony Cyber-shot DSC-G1. Pretty exciting sin;t it?

The innovative DSC-GI has a 6 megapixel resolution and has been equipped with a 3.5-inch LCD viewfinder screen without touch capabilities. However the most interesting feature of the camera is its wireless capabilities as the camera can share photos using 802.11b/g Wi-Fi with other cameras, PCs, and devices which employ the Digital Living Network Alliance (DLNA) spec.

Other features include; 3&tims; optical zoom, 2 GB of internal memory, support for Sony's Memory Stick Duo and Memory Stick Pro Duo cards, with available capacities up to 8 GB., ISO 1000 sensitivity, and features on-board keywording, playback, and slideshow capabilities. The DSC-G1 should be available at retailers this April at prices around $600.

"This is a step towards realizing a platform for networked photo communication," said Phil Lubell, director of marketing for digital cameras at Sony Electronics, in a release. "We will continue to explore the possibilities for networked digital imaging as broadband Internet becomes more pervasive in American homes."
